Willis City Council rezones 11.16 acres to allow Cannan Place and Camp Creek Apartments

City Council of the City of Willis · September 23, 2025
AI-Generated Content: All content on this page was generated by AI to highlight key points from the meeting. For complete details and context, we recommend watching the full video. so we can fix them.

Summary

The Council unanimously rezoned about 11.16 acres from General Commercial to Multi‑Family to permit the development of Cannan Place and Camp Creek Apartments; staff said the property had been replatted previously but needed the official zoning change.

The City Council of the City of Willis on Sept. 23, 2025 approved an ordinance amending the official zoning map to reclassify a tract of approximately 11.16 acres in the G.W. Lonis Survey, Abstract 313, from General Commercial to Multi‑Family to allow construction of two multifamily projects, Cannan Place and Camp Creek Apartments.

Jess Cross, Chief Building Official, told the Council the property had been previously replatted for multifamily use but the official rezoning action had not yet been completed; the ordinance updates the zoning map and includes associated infrastructure, drainage, and utility improvements required for development. Councilman Thomas Belinoski moved approval; Councilman Barney Stone seconded and the motion passed unanimously.

No public comments were recorded during the joint public hearing on the item. The rezoning authorizes staff and developers to proceed with permitting and site work consistent with the approved zoning; any subsequent plats, site plans or building permits will follow the City’s standard review process.
